"Their address is wrong on any maps app. if you plug in their official address, you get a spot 2km from the location, a different campground that is much closer to town. Feels like a bait and switch. Also - not for the quiet traveller. Even though they have "quiet hours from 0-8, they don't mention the nighly shows by the central pool that run from 21:30 to 00:00 and reverberate through THE ENTIRE CAMPGROUND. Good luck getting an early night. The expectation there is that you will only sleep...
